Category: Integrated Circuit (IC)
Use: LM224ADR is a quad operational amplifier that is widely used in various electronic circuits for amplification, filtering, and signal conditioning purposes.
Characteristics: - Low input offset voltage - Low input bias current - High gain bandwidth product - Wide supply voltage range - Rail-to-rail output swing capability
Package: SOIC-14
Essence: LM224ADR is an essential component in electronic devices where precise amplification and signal processing are required.
Packaging/Quantity: LM224ADR is typically packaged in reels or tubes, with each reel containing 2500 units.

Advantages: - Low input offset voltage ensures precise amplification - High gain bandwidth product enables accurate signal processing - Rail-to-rail output swing capability maximizes signal range - Wide supply voltage range offers versatility in different circuits
Disadvantages: - Limited slew rate may restrict high-speed signal processing - Lower common mode rejection ratio compared to some other models
LM224ADR operates based on the principles of operational amplifiers. It amplifies the difference between the input voltages applied to its inputs and produces an amplified output signal. The internal circuitry of LM224ADR ensures low input offset voltage, high gain, and rail-to-rail output swing.
LM224ADR finds extensive use in various electronic applications, including but not limited to: 1. Audio amplifiers 2. Active filters 3. Signal conditioners 4. Instrumentation amplifiers 5. Voltage-controlled oscillators
Some alternative models that can be considered as alternatives to LM224ADR are: 1. LM324ADR 2. LM358ADR 3. TL074CN 4. OP07CP 5. MCP6004-I/P
These models offer similar functionality and characteristics, providing options for different design requirements.

Q: What is LM224ADR? A: LM224ADR is a quad operational amplifier (op-amp) that is commonly used in various electronic circuits.
Q: What is the voltage supply range for LM224ADR? A: The voltage supply range for LM224ADR is typically between +3V and +32V.
Q: What is the maximum output current of LM224ADR? A: The maximum output current of LM224ADR is around 20mA.
Q: Can LM224ADR be used in low-power applications? A: Yes, LM224ADR is suitable for low-power applications as it has a low quiescent current consumption.
Q: What is the input offset voltage of LM224ADR? A: The input offset voltage of LM224ADR is typically around 2mV.
Q: Is LM224ADR suitable for audio applications? A: Yes, LM224ADR can be used in audio applications such as audio amplifiers and equalizers.
Q: Can LM224ADR operate in a wide temperature range? A: Yes, LM224ADR is designed to operate in a wide temperature range, typically from -40°C to +125°C.
Q: What is the typical gain bandwidth product of LM224ADR? A: The typical gain bandwidth product of LM224ADR is around 1MHz.
Q: Can LM224ADR be used in single-supply applications? A: Yes, LM224ADR can be used in single-supply applications by connecting the negative supply pin to ground.
Q: Are there any recommended external components for LM224ADR? A: It is recommended to use decoupling capacitors at the power supply pins and input/output resistors for stability and protection.
